Haven't watched the video yet, but there were 12 of those used for test beds. The result, we got our '82 CHP Mustangs!! :)
There's an HB Halicki sequel to Gone In 60 Seconds that has mock ups of those '79 Camaros and also some Firebirds as CHP pursuit cars. |
Jim Post had one of the original 12 and sold it.
I remember being at his museum when he decided to sell it and I now kick myself for not buying it!!! Last I heard it belonged to a retired Ca. officer who now lives in UT. It had been completely restored and was a correct version except for the engine. As far as I know this is the only one left. There are several clones. |
